  • High School Diploma or equivalent (Apprentice Plumber)
  • Enrollment in a recognized Plumber Apprenticeship Program (Apprentice Plumber)
  • Completion of a four-year plumber’s apprenticeship program (minimum 576 classroom hours) (Journeyman Plumber)
  • 4 years (8,000 hours) of licensed plumbing experience under the supervision of a licensed Journeyperson or Master plumber (Journeyman Plumber)
  • Successful completion of the Utah Plumber Theory and Practical exams (Journeyman Plumber).
  • 4 years (8,000 hours) of experience as a licensed Journeyperson Plumber (Master Plumber)
  • Successful completion of the Utah Master Plumber Law and Rule Examination (Master Plumber)
